Improved GaN[sub x]As[sub 1−x] quality grown by molecular beam epitaxy with dispersive nitrogen source
A modified mode for GaAsN growth using solid-source molecular beam epitaxy in conjunction with dispersive nitrogen to avoid the bombardment effect of energetic nitrogen ions is reported. High-quality GaAsN epilayers and good GaAsN/GaAs interfaces were achieved using this growth mode. The results...
